TechFlow news: South Korea's well-known decentralized exchange KLAYswap has partnered with multi-chain wallet BitKeep, now supporting integration with the BitKeep Wallet. Users can connect via the BitKeep browser extension to perform operations on KLAYswap such as token swaps, staking, and liquidity mining. Previously, BitKeep Swap had already implemented aggregated support for KLAYswap, providing mobile and browser extension users with liquidity and trading services within the Klaytn network.
The BitKeep Wallet supports over 90 public blockchains and integrates key features including wallet management, Swap trading, NFT marketplace, DApp browser, and Launchpad. Its built-in on-chain aggregated trading service, BitKeep Swap, covers more than 20 blockchains and enables cross-chain trading across 17 chains. It supports multiple trading modes such as market orders and limit orders, and through its innovative "Gas Borrowing" feature, allows users to complete transactions even without holding native gas tokens.
